Direkte Abfrage eines Tastendrucks

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• Für was gibts wohl die Hilfe?
    keyboard_check_direct(key)
    Returns whether the key with the particular keycode is pressed by checking the hardware directly. The result is independent of which application has focus. It allows for a few more checks. In particular you can use keycodes vk_lshift, vk_lcontrol, vk_lalt, vk_rshift, vk_rcontrol and vk_ralt to check whether the left or right shift, control or alt key is pressed.


    Dragoon
    int (*x(*x(int))[5])(int*);
    Confused? Yes, it's C!
  • Wenn das Spiel nicht im Vordergrund ist kannst du nur prüfen, ob die Taste momentan gedrückt ist. Mechanismen zum Feststellen von Betätigung und Loslassen musst du dann selber entwickeln, mit einer Variable, in der der vorherige Zustand der Taste gespeichert ist, ist das aber nicht weiter schwer.
    "Die Erde ist ein Irrenhaus. Dabei könnte das bis heute erreichte Wissen der Menschheit aus ihr ein Paradies machen. Dafür müsste die weltweite Gesellschaft allerdings zur Vernunft kommen."
    - Joseph Weizenbaum